We are looking for a PHP developer to help us maintain and grow our infrastructure, especially our CRM. Your job will be to develop new features and sometimes entire systems. Your main role will be development, but you may occasionally be called into support end-users.
Also: sometimes you’ll be bug hunting in existing platforms, and sometimes we’ll drop everything to respond to a political event. And sometimes you’ll be working with the Director of IT to reimagine the fundamentals.
We need someone able to turn their hand to anything in a complex system, as well as willing to learn the right tool for the job. You don’t have to be an expert, just happy to learn and try.
We also want to develop our automated testing and general DevOps approach – if you can help with that, fantastic.
Qualifications
The job is heavy on PHP, focusing on our (heavily-customised) CiviCRM and WordPress. There’ll be javascript work too – often in Gutenberg, which is basically React. We use javascript frameworks for front end work: bespoke forms, petitions, donations, and the occasional sprinkling of magic. But we’re not building complex SPAs and you don’t need to be a full React/Vue/etc developer. If you find htmx pleasing, this may be the job for you.
We’re looking for someone who is motivated by a good cause and who springs into action with ideas and solutions. You might be working in a junior tech role and looking for a promotion, or interested in a lateral move to a charity so you can dedicate yourself to a cause you really care about.
Our ideal candidate probably has a few years of experience as a software engineer or website developer already, but we’re much more interested in raw talent, knowledge, and enthusiasm than we are in someone with X years of experience.
As such, we are open to working with new graduates. This is a great first job: you’ll get experience with all sorts of tools and systems, and we iterate fast: your work will be deployed quickly and regularly. There’s also a lot of flexibility to implement modern systems and leave your mark. But you’ll need to demonstrate that you have experience with the technologies we’re using and what we’re trying to achieve.
Either way, you’ll need to be someone who is self-motivated, efficient, and who takes real pride in their work. You’ll show patience and understanding when discussing tickets and needs brought to the IT team by non-technical colleagues, exploring the nuts and bolts of how their areas of the organisation work, and at times directing them to reshape and redefine what they need.
We put a high priority on being able to see things from the perspective of a less-IT-literate user. We believe this is key to developing successful systems. This comes from our axiom that an IT department should maintain a positive and friendly relationship with all staff and volunteers. So you’ll need to demonstrate some experience of understanding user experience – be it from IT support, testing, or similar.
